Switch语句是一种分支语句,常用于多分支的情况。
比如;
输入1,星期一
输入2,星期二
输入3,星期三
输入4,星期四
输入5,星期五
如果写成if的形式太复杂,这个时候我们就需要写成switch的语句来表达。
Switch语句;
switch(整型表达式)
{
语句项;
}
但是一些语句项我们将常用一些case语句来表达,
case整形常量表达式:
语句;
接下来我们代码演示;
注意;case因为是一个关键字后面加上空格。
两张图比较中我们知道在switch语句中的break的重要性,在switch语句中,我们一般往往无法直接实现分支语句的运行,所以经常搭配break才能实现真正的分支。
所以我们要知道 break是打破语句的;continue是跳过本次循环后面的代码两者有这本质的区别。
下节我们分享循环语句
同时break和continue有什么本质区别???